[CIDE DICTIONARY]

yodel, v. t. & i. [G. jodeln.].

   To sing in a manner common among the Swiss and Tyrolese mountaineers, by suddenly changing from the head voice, or falsetto, to the chest voice, and the contrary; to warble. [1913 Webster]


yodel, n.

   A song sung by yodeling, as by the Swiss mountaineers. [1913 Webster]


[OXFORD DICTIONARY]

yodel, v. & n.
--v.tr. & intr. (yodelled, yodelling; US yodeled, yodeling) sing with melodious inarticulate sounds and frequent changes between falsetto and the normal voice in the manner of the Swiss mountain-dwellers.
--n. a yodelling cry.

Derivative:
yodeller n.

Etymology:
G jodeln
